Proteomic analysis and glucose metabolism in the heart (IMAGE)
Caption
(A) Proteomics protein identification and quantitative results statistics. (B) A Venn diagram showed the overlapping differentially expressed proteins between the RCM group and the WT group. (C) The principal component analysis of all samples. (D) GO annotation statistics of differentially expressed proteins in the RCM_vs_WT group. The ordinate represented the secondary GO function annotation information, including biological processes, molecular functions, and cell components, which were successively distinguished by blue, red, and orange. The abscissa indicated the number of differentially expressed proteins in each functional category. (E) KEGG enrichment analysis, top20 KEGG TopMapStat sorted by the number of proteins enriched on the KEGG pathway, and up-down-regulation analysis of KEGG enrichment pathway. The blue represents down-regulation and the red represents up-regulation. (F) Glucose content in heart tissue (n = 3). (G) Lactic acid content in heart tissue (WT, n = 5; cTnI193His-M, n = 4). ∗∗P < 0.01.
